PAYROLL GIVINGCAF Give As You Earn is the leading UK Payroll Giving scheme that enables employees to give to any UK charity straight from their salary. With Payroll Giving you can provide our charity, Mitchell’s Miracles, with a regular donation which means that we will be able to effectively plan ahead and budget for the future. BACKPACK APPEALWhen a child receives antibodies, they need to be hooked up to a pump and stay in hospital for up to a week. However, by having a small backpack, the pump (baby bottle sized) can fit inside allowing a child to have more freedom as opposed to pushing around a medicine stand. Having a backpack also means that a child can go home whilst the antibody is still being infused.
